Overview
Rugbot is a technical paper exploring the design and construction of a robotic system capable of tying Turkish knots — the foundational double-loop knot used in traditional hand-knotted rug weaving. The paper covers the mechanical design, motion planning, and knot-tying sequence required to automate a craft that has been done entirely by hand for centuries. It bridges robotics, textile engineering, and traditional craft in a way that is both practically grounded and original.
